Output 27523057298a82340afa8248fd625020d2feb26e12b83dffd622db14c8f68dc6:0

value
10464590
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6de613917ae6dd4ed2a310392a99300da92805a5 OP_EQUALVERIFY OP_CHECKSIG
address
1B26GuF2rGUnzu5Q3vqPEEE46AvwrDfbUc
transaction
27523057298a82340afa8248fd625020d2feb26e12b83dffd622db14c8f68dc6
spent
true